the annual texas triangle IR conference
Each year, we bring together scholars of international relations from universities from across the Lone Star State to present their research, with a particular focus on junior faculty and graduate students.
The conference will be hosted by UT Dallas in 2025. The Political Economy, Public Policy, and Political Science Program is hosting the event, with the support from the School of Economic, Political and Policy Sciences.

The conference prioritizes junior faculty and grad students, but senior faculties are welcome to submit their proposals as well. Each paper will get 30 minutes, with 15 min dedicated to presentation and 15 min to Q&A. If you’d like to submit a paper for consideration, send a title and abstract to [email protected], and if you are a graduate student, let us know your advisor’s name. We’ll also pair papers with faculty discussants, who will provide comments separately, whether in writing or during some downtime during the conference.
